Everything about Palawano Language totally explainedThe Palawano languages are spoken on the island of Palawan in the province of Palawan in the Philippines.
There are actually three related, but not mutually intelligible, languages (each with a number of subdialects) which called themselves "Palawano" (called Palawan in their own term; "Palawano" is a Spanish term used by outsiders.)
Populations are approximate. These there are:
- Brooke's Point Palawano: 14,367 speakers (ISO 639-3 code plw)
- Central Palawano: 12,000 speakers (ISO 639-3 code plc)
- Southwest Palawano: 12,000 speakers (ISO 639-3 code plv)
The three Palawano languages are closely related to the following languages, as all stemming from a hypothezise "Proto-Palawan" language. They are not truly cognate, but share a fair amount of vocabulary:
Batak (ISO 639-3 code bya)
Molbog (ISO 639-3 code pwm)
Tagbanwa (ISO 639-3 code tbw)
All are spoken predominantly in the Philippines.
